Stones River Manor receives highly polarized feedback, with many long-term families praising the compassionate staff and effective rehabilitation services. However, recent reports from late 2024 raise serious concerns regarding hygiene, specifically citing bedbug infestations and inadequate infection control protocols. Families should weigh the facility's history of dedicated care against these recent, alarming reports of facility maintenance and administrative oversight.

This facility meets both EveryPlace staffing reference benchmarks. Higher staffing is generally associated with stronger day-to-day care.
Reference benchmarks (0.75 RN and 4.1 total nursing hours per resident/day) are comparison targets, not current federal minimum requirements.

Stones River Manor has faced recurring challenges across multiple areas, with families filing complaints that triggered investigations for issues including failure to report suspected abuse and inadequate care planning. The facility shows persistent problems with care planning and assessment, infection control, and building safety requirements, with the same corridor obstruction issue appearing in both 2022 and 2025 surveys. While all deficiencies show correction dates, the pattern of repeat violations across care planning and safety areas warrants careful consideration during any visit.
